Why Do You Need Travel Insurance for Israel?
- Medical Costs – Healthcare in Israel is high-quality but can be expensive for foreign visitors. Without insurance, even a minor treatment could cost hundreds of dollars.
- Travel Risks – Flight cancellations, lost luggage, and delays are common during international trips. Insurance ensures you’re financially protected.
- Adventure Activities – Many tourists enjoy hiking, diving, or desert tours in Israel. Travel insurance can cover injuries from such activities.
- Visa Requirements – While Israel doesn’t always mandate insurance for tourists, having proof of coverage makes your entry smoother and stress-free.
What Does Travel Insurance for Israel Cover?
Most standard travel insurance policies include:
- ✅ Emergency Medical Treatment – Hospitalization, doctor consultations, ambulance services.
- ✅ COVID-19 Coverage – Some plans include treatment and quarantine expenses.
- ✅ Trip Cancellation/Interruption – Reimbursement if you cancel due to illness or emergencies.
- ✅ Lost or Delayed Baggage – Compensation for lost suitcases or delayed delivery.
- ✅ Emergency Evacuation – Transport to another country or back home if needed.
- ✅ Personal Liability – Covers damages caused accidentally to others.
Exclusions – What’s Not Covered?
- Pre-existing medical conditions (unless you buy an add-on).
- Traveling against medical advice.
- Adventure sports not listed in the policy.
- Claims made under alcohol or drug influence.
- War or terrorism-related risks (some insurers provide optional add-ons for this).
Cost of Travel Insurance for Israel
The cost depends on:
- Traveler’s Age (senior citizens may pay more)
- Duration of Stay (short trips are cheaper than long stays)
- Coverage Amount (higher coverage = higher premium)
👉 On average, travel insurance for Israel costs $30 – $60 for a 7–10 day trip with standard coverage. Comprehensive plans with adventure or pre-existing illness cover may go up to $100+.
How to Choose the Best Travel Insurance for Israel
- Check Medical Coverage Limit – Ensure at least $50,000–$100,000 coverage.
- Look for Adventure Sports Add-ons – If you plan desert hikes, diving, or trekking.
- 24/7 Assistance – Pick an insurer offering emergency support worldwide.
- COVID-19 and Political Unrest Coverage – Helpful in Israel’s dynamic environment.
- Compare Providers – Use comparison tools to check premiums and benefits.

Tips for Travelers to Israel
- Carry a printed copy of your insurance policy while traveling.
- Save the emergency helpline number of your insurer.
- If you have health issues, declare them in advance to avoid claim rejection.
- Buy insurance before your trip starts, not after departure.
